Company History and Business Evolution (450+ Words)
Vision Digital Systems Ltd was founded in 2012 by Dr. Alistair Reeves and Sarah Chen, two former Accenture consultants who identified a gap in the market for agile, outcome-driven digital transformation services. Starting as a small boutique consultancy in a shared office space in Shoreditch, London, the company initially focused on cloud migration projects for early-stage fintech startups. Its big break came in 2014 when it secured a contract with a major UK bank to modernize its legacy infrastructure, delivering a 40% cost reduction within 18 months. This success fueled rapid expansion: by 2016, Vision Digital Systems Ltd had opened offices in New York and Singapore, and its employee count surpassed 500. In 2017, the company made its first acquisition—DataVault AI, a niche data security firm—which laid the foundation for its cybersecurity practice. The following year, it launched its proprietary platform, VisonAI, a machine learning engine for predictive analytics, which quickly gained traction in the healthcare and retail sectors. The period 2019-2021 was marked by aggressive growth: two more acquisitions (CloudBridge Ltd and PulseIoT) expanded its cloud and IoT capabilities, and the company achieved unicorn status with a valuation exceeding $1 billion after a Series C funding round led by Sequoia Capital. During the pandemic, Vision Digital Systems Ltd demonstrated resilience by pivoting to remote delivery models and launching a Digital Workplace suite that helped hundreds of enterprises transition to hybrid work environments. In 2022, the company went public on the London Stock Exchange (ticker: VDSL), raising £350 million for further innovation. Since then, it has continued to evolve, establishing a Quantum Computing Lab in partnership with the University of Cambridge and unveiling a comprehensive ESG reporting tool. Today, Vision Digital Systems Ltd is a global powerhouse with over 4,500 employees, serving clients in 35 countries.
